National Recruiting Coordinator salary in Morocco

Average Yearly Salary of National Recruiting Coordinator in Morocco is approximately 147,525 MAD (13,405 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does National Recruiting Coordinator do?

occupation personasThe occupation of a National Recruiting Coordinator involves overseeing the recruitment process for an organization on a national level. This role requires developing and implementing effective strategies to attract and select top talent across multiple locations. The National Recruiting Coordinator collaborates with hiring managers to understand their staffing needs, creates job postings, and advertises positions through various channels. They also screen resumes, conduct interviews, and coordinate assessments to identify the most suitable candidates. Additionally, they may negotiate offers and facilitate the onboarding process. This role requires strong communication and interpersonal skills, as well as the ability to multitask and work in a fast-paced environment.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ary. The salary increase over years of experience can vary widely based on factors such as job industry, job role, location, company size, and individual performance.
